Biogeomagnetism

Biogeomagnetism is the study of how living organisms, especially humans and animals, are affected by Earth's magnetic field. Our bodies contain tiny magnetic particles that can respond to magnetic forces, influencing biological processes like navigation, circadian rhythms, and even brain activity. Some researchers explore how magnetic exposure might impact health or behavior, and animals use Earth's magnetic signals for migration. Overall, biogeomagnetism examines the interplay between Earth's magnetic environment and biological systems, helping us understand how magnetic fields influence living organisms in subtle yet significant ways.
